Job Description

The LEXIS Group, LLC is currently seeking qualified Transportation Construction Inspectors (TCI) for a Highway and Bridge projects in  District 2 in McKean, Potter, Elk, Cameron, Clinton, Clearfield, Centre, Mifflin & Juniata Counties  in Pennsylvania. 

Hourly rate starting at approximately $20-35/hr. depending on qualifications, education, and certifications. LEXIS offers several additional benefits, such as a Night Shift Incentive and a Long-Distance Drive Incentive that can add additional earnings to your pay.

Primary Respon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:

  • Review plans and specifications during design and/or bidding phase, manage on-site supervision and inspection of construction activities, quality control provisions of contracts, and periodic inspections and tests.
  • Review and evaluate field staff construction progress, quality assurance findings, recommended field and office engineering changes for consistency with contractual provisions, specifications and cost estimates. 
  • Inspect construction operations on roads and bridges to ensure work is done in contract's special provisions.
  • Observe, investigate, and report on all stages of construction
  • Record personal and contractor work in field inspection diaries, item quantity books and sketch/composition books.
  • Analyze the contract plans, specifications and contract special provisions and explain the contract requirements to contractor personnel and others making inquiry.
  • Coordinate the planning, design, cost engineering, construction, and environmental considerations for engineering projects of various complexities.
  • Note controversies with contractors and other agencies.
  • Maintain a daily log/diary to adequately document accept/reject work performed.
  • Record incidents of unsatisfactory performance and violations of specifications and regulations.
  • Measure and record progress quantities on a daily basis for use in reviewing contractor monthly invoices. ​​​​​​​

Requirements :

  • Candidates must have a minimum of two years of PennDOT, Pennsylvania Turnpike, or related transportation construction experience.
  • GED or high school diploma required.
  • Degree in Civil Engineering preferred.

Required Certifications:

  • PennDOT Concrete
  • NECEPT Field Tech
  • NICET Level II

Preferred Certifications 

  • NECEPT bituminous and concrete
  • ACI
  • CDS NextGen
  • KAHUA
  • Resumes must include detailed work histories, certification numbers, and expiration dates.
